Middlesbrough Shooting: Attempted Murder Charges After Gunfire Rocks Middlebeck Close

A terrifying shooting incident in Middlesbrough has resulted in multiple arrests and attempted murder charges, after shots were fired at a residential property in Middlebeck Close, Thorntree, on the night of May 7, 2025.

Gunfire Erupts in Residential Street

Cleveland Police responded to reports of a firearm discharge at a property at around 11:10 p.m. Although no injuries were reported, the incident sparked a major investigation and led to a cordon being placed around the scene.

[block_2]

Detective Chief Inspector Dave Snaith of Cleveland Police reassured the public, saying:

“We don’t believe there’s a wider threat, but we’re committed to finding those responsible. High-visibility patrols will continue in the area.”
